Bjorn storms clear after six straight birdies
VIRGINIA WATER England (Reuters) – An exhilarating run of six birdies in a row, two shy of the European Tour record, catapulted veteran Thomas Bjorn into a five-stroke lead after the BMW PGA Championship third round on Saturday.
Russia and Finland reach final at world championship
(Reuters) – Russia came from behind to earn a 3-1 win over holders Sweden in the semi-finals of the world ice hockey championship on Saturday and will meet Finland, who overcame the Czech Republic 3-0, in the gold medal match.

Colorado’s Arenado suffers finger injury in loss to Braves
(Reuters) – Colorado’s promising young third baseman Nolan Arenado fractured a finger during a headfirst slide against the Atlanta Braves on Friday.
Scott six shots behind surprise leader at Colonial
(Reuters) – Little-known Brice Garnett took control of the Crowne Plaza Invitational in Texas on Friday as world number one Adam Scott ended a frustrating day on the greens with a long birdie putt at the last to finish six shots off the pace.
